In general, the fees for a B.Com programme range from INR 7,000 to INR 28,300. In hindu it is INR 54780. IN SRCC it is 15000 for B.Com (Hons). For female hostel, it is 10.45k per year in DU.

To get direct university in B.Com you can search for colleges without CUET
You can watch these universities if you are from Bihar or near it-
1. Patliputra university
2. Magadh university
3. Nalanda University
4. Munger universit
These are some good and reputed universities in Bihar where you can get admission on the basis of your intermediate marks.
